If a prelimin general surgery resident took the absite last year and now matched to a categorcial PGY-1 position this year, will he be grouped with the PGY-1 group or the PGY-2 group ? Thanks

pgy1 (actually R1 is more appropiate) b/c that is his class year

Like all the research residents who are pgy3, pgy-4, ect, they have only done 2 clinical years, and thus still take the junior absite and are lumped with the R2 class
